Re: load test config for the Tillbox checkout flow — looks fine overall, but the rate limiter is bypassed in the test harness, which means these numbers won't reflect production throttling. Security-wise, ensure the synthetic card tokens stay in the sandbox pool. Please confirm the harness enforces the same abuse thresholds as prod. For reference, the limits under test are these.

tuning constants:
PRIORITIES = {
    "novath": 389,
    "kelix": 751,
}

## Runbook: Order Cutoff Misfires at Ovenlight

Heads up, future maintainer: the Ovenlight bakery platform enforces a 13:30 cutoff for same-day orders, and the evaluator occasionally drifts when the scheduler host's clock skews. Symptom: customers see next-day slots before 13:30, or same-day slots after. First check NTP sync on the scheduler box, then confirm the cutoff config matches the store's declared timezone. If both look fine, force a cache flush on the cutoff service via its admin endpoint, authenticating with the key below.

gateway credential: kto7_GoY89Me

Minutes – Management Meeting, Brindlevale Ltd

Quick update for the board: churn in the Glimmerpath pilot hit 14% last month, mostly smaller accounts in the Ostwick region. Marla thinks onboarding friction is the culprit; Dev agreed to simplify setup by next sprint. Retention calls start Monday. We'll know more after the cohort review. The confidential plan summary follows below.

management briefing: Only 5 of the 80 pilot accounts renewed Zorix, so a churn review is set for October 1.

- [ ] **Step 7: Breaker override escrow.** After sealing the signing keys for the Tallgrove upstream API circuit breaker, confirm the support team can force the breaker open during a full outage. The override bundle lives in the sealed escrow drawer and is useless without its unlock phrase. Two ceremony witnesses must initial this step before proceeding. The escrow bundle is decrypted with the recovery passphrase that follows.

vault phrase of kahip-kahop = holath-quenmir